You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@sling.apache.org by tm...@apache.org on 2018/02/02 16:50:20 UTC
[sling-org-apache-sling-distribution-core] branch master updated
(d50eac3 -> 7317793)
This is an automated email from the ASF dual-hosted git repository.
tmaret pushed a change to branch master
in repository https://gitbox.apache.org/repos/asf/sling-org-apache-sling-distribution-core.git.
from d50eac3 SLING-7462 - DistributionEventDistributeDistributionTriggerTest fails sporadically
add 26c217c SLING-7168 - Allow to implement custom distribution queue
add effe26c SLING-7168 - Allow to implement custom distribution queue
add 7317793 SLING-7168 - Allow to implement custom distribution queue
No new revisions were added by this update.
Summary of changes:
pom.xml | 8 +++++++-
.../agent/impl/AbstractDistributionAgentFactory.java | 2 +-
.../agent/impl/ForwardDistributionAgentFactory.java | 10 +++++-----
.../impl/ImportingDistributionPackageProcessor.java | 4 ++--
.../agent/impl/QueueDistributionAgentFactory.java | 8 ++++----
.../impl/QueueingDistributionPackageProcessor.java | 4 ++--
.../agent/impl/ReverseDistributionAgentFactory.java | 10 +++++-----
.../agent/impl/SimpleDistributionAgent.java | 18 +++++++++---------
.../agent/impl/SimpleDistributionAgentFactory.java | 10 +++++-----
.../impl/SimpleDistributionAgentQueueProcessor.java | 8 ++++----
.../agent/impl/SyncDistributionAgentFactory.java | 10 +++++-----
.../agent/impl/TriggerAgentRequestHandler.java | 2 +-
.../distribution/{queue => agent}/package-info.java | 4 ++--
.../agent/{ => spi}/DistributionAgent.java | 15 ++++++++-------
.../distribution/{util => agent/spi}/package-info.java | 3 ++-
.../impl/DefaultDistributionComponentProvider.java | 8 ++++----
.../component/impl/DistributionComponentKind.java | 8 ++++----
.../sling/distribution/impl/DefaultDistributor.java | 2 +-
.../distribution/log/impl/DefaultDistributionLog.java | 2 +-
.../distribution/log/{ => spi}/DistributionLog.java | 7 +++++--
.../distribution/{util => log/spi}/package-info.java | 3 ++-
.../monitor/DistributionQueueHealthCheck.java | 4 ++--
.../monitor/impl/DistributionQueueMBeanImpl.java | 2 +-
.../impl/ForwardDistributionAgentMBeanImpl.java | 2 +-
.../impl/MonitoringDistributionQueueProvider.java | 6 +++---
.../monitor/impl/QueueDistributionAgentMBeanImpl.java | 2 +-
.../impl/ReverseDistributionAgentMBeanImpl.java | 2 +-
.../monitor/impl/SimpleDistributionAgentMBeanImpl.java | 2 +-
.../monitor/impl/SyncDistributionAgentMBeanImpl.java | 2 +-
.../{ => impl}/DistributionPackageBuilderProvider.java | 3 ++-
.../{ => impl}/DistributionPackageExporter.java | 10 ++++++----
.../{ => impl}/DistributionPackageImporter.java | 4 +++-
.../{ => impl}/DistributionPackageProcessor.java | 3 ++-
.../exporter/AgentDistributionPackageExporter.java | 12 ++++++------
.../AgentDistributionPackageExporterFactory.java | 8 ++++----
.../exporter/LocalDistributionPackageExporter.java | 6 +++---
.../LocalDistributionPackageExporterFactory.java | 4 ++--
.../exporter/RemoteDistributionPackageExporter.java | 6 +++---
.../RemoteDistributionPackageExporterFactory.java | 4 ++--
.../importer/LocalDistributionPackageImporter.java | 4 ++--
.../LocalDistributionPackageImporterFactory.java | 2 +-
.../importer/RemoteDistributionPackageImporter.java | 4 ++--
.../RemoteDistributionPackageImporterFactory.java | 2 +-
.../RepositoryDistributionPackageImporter.java | 4 ++--
.../RepositoryDistributionPackageImporterFactory.java | 2 +-
.../distribution/{util => packaging}/package-info.java | 3 ++-
.../distribution/queue/DistributionQueueEntry.java | 2 ++
.../distribution/queue/DistributionQueueItem.java | 3 ++-
.../queue/DistributionQueueItemStatus.java | 4 +++-
.../distribution/queue/DistributionQueueStatus.java | 6 +++++-
.../distribution/queue/DistributionQueueType.java | 2 ++
.../queue/impl/AsyncDeliveryDispatchingStrategy.java | 1 +
.../queue/impl/CachingDistributionQueue.java | 2 +-
.../impl/DistributionQueueDispatchingStrategy.java | 10 +++++-----
.../queue/{ => impl}/DistributionQueueProcessor.java | 9 ++++++---
.../queue/{ => impl}/DistributionQueueProvider.java | 5 ++++-
.../queue/impl/DistributionQueueWrapper.java | 2 +-
.../queue/impl/ErrorQueueDispatchingStrategy.java | 3 +--
.../queue/impl/MultipleQueueDispatchingStrategy.java | 3 +--
.../queue/impl/PriorityQueueDispatchingStrategy.java | 1 -
.../queue/impl/SimpleAgentDistributionQueue.java | 2 +-
.../impl/jobhandling/DistributionAgentJobConsumer.java | 5 +++--
.../impl/jobhandling/JobHandlingDistributionQueue.java | 4 ++--
.../JobHandlingDistributionQueueProvider.java | 10 +++++-----
.../queue/impl/simple/SimpleDistributionQueue.java | 4 ++--
.../impl/simple/SimpleDistributionQueueCheckpoint.java | 2 +-
.../impl/simple/SimpleDistributionQueueProcessor.java | 4 ++--
.../impl/simple/SimpleDistributionQueueProvider.java | 10 +++++-----
.../apache/sling/distribution/queue/package-info.java | 2 +-
.../queue/{ => spi}/DistributionQueue.java | 18 +++++++++++++-----
.../distribution/{util => queue/spi}/package-info.java | 3 ++-
.../ExtendedDistributionServiceResourceProvider.java | 6 +++---
.../DefaultDistributionPackageBuilderProvider.java | 2 +-
.../servlet/DistributionAgentCreationFilter.java | 2 +-
.../servlet/DistributionAgentLogServlet.java | 5 +++--
.../servlet/DistributionAgentQueueServlet.java | 8 ++++----
.../distribution/servlet/DistributionAgentServlet.java | 4 ++--
.../servlet/DistributionPackageExporterServlet.java | 4 ++--
.../servlet/DistributionPackageImporterServlet.java | 2 +-
.../trigger/impl/ScheduledDistributionTrigger.java | 3 ++-
.../ImportingDistributionPackageProcessorTest.java | 2 +-
.../impl/QueueingDistributionPackageProcessorTest.java | 2 +-
.../SimpleDistributionAgentQueueProcessorTest.java | 6 +++---
.../agent/impl/SimpleDistributionAgentTest.java | 10 +++++-----
.../agent/impl/TriggerAgentRequestHandlerTest.java | 2 +-
.../monitor/DistributionQueueHealthCheckTest.java | 17 +++++++++--------
.../monitor/impl/DistributionQueueMBeanTest.java | 2 +-
.../impl/ForwardDistributionAgentMBeanTest.java | 2 +-
.../monitor/impl/QueueDistributionAgentMBeanTest.java | 2 +-
.../impl/ReverseDistributionAgentMBeanTest.java | 2 +-
.../monitor/impl/SimpleDistributionAgentMBeanTest.java | 2 +-
.../monitor/impl/SyncDistributionAgentMBeanTest.java | 2 +-
.../exporter/AgentDistributionPackageExporterTest.java | 6 +++---
.../exporter/LocalDistributionPackageExporterTest.java | 2 +-
.../RemoteDistributionPackageExporterTest.java | 2 +-
.../impl/AsyncDeliveryDispatchingStrategyTest.java | 7 ++++---
.../impl/PriorityQueueDispatchingStrategyTest.java | 3 +--
.../impl/SingleQueueDistributionStrategyTest.java | 18 ++++++++++++------
.../jobhandling/DistributionAgentJobConsumerTest.java | 2 +-
.../JobHandlingDistributionQueueProviderTest.java | 4 ++--
.../jobhandling/JobHandlingDistributionQueueTest.java | 2 +-
.../simple/SimpleDistributionQueueCheckpointTest.java | 2 +-
.../simple/SimpleDistributionQueueProcessorTest.java | 7 ++++---
.../simple/SimpleDistributionQueueProviderTest.java | 4 ++--
.../queue/impl/simple/SimpleDistributionQueueTest.java | 12 ++++++------
105 files changed, 289 insertions(+), 235 deletions(-)
copy src/main/java/org/apache/sling/distribution/{queue => agent}/package-info.java (93%)
rename src/main/java/org/apache/sling/distribution/agent/{ => spi}/DistributionAgent.java (87%)
copy src/main/java/org/apache/sling/distribution/{util => agent/spi}/package-info.java (92%)
rename src/main/java/org/apache/sling/distribution/log/{ => spi}/DistributionLog.java (85%)
copy src/main/java/org/apache/sling/distribution/{util => log/spi}/package-info.java (92%)
rename src/main/java/org/apache/sling/distribution/packaging/{ => impl}/DistributionPackageBuilderProvider.java (91%)
rename src/main/java/org/apache/sling/distribution/packaging/{ => impl}/DistributionPackageExporter.java (90%)
rename src/main/java/org/apache/sling/distribution/packaging/{ => impl}/DistributionPackageImporter.java (92%)
rename src/main/java/org/apache/sling/distribution/packaging/{ => impl}/DistributionPackageProcessor.java (91%)
copy src/main/java/org/apache/sling/distribution/{util => packaging}/package-info.java (92%)
rename src/main/java/org/apache/sling/distribution/queue/{ => impl}/DistributionQueueProcessor.java (76%)
rename src/main/java/org/apache/sling/distribution/queue/{ => impl}/DistributionQueueProvider.java (91%)
rename src/main/java/org/apache/sling/distribution/queue/{ => spi}/DistributionQueue.java (83%)
copy src/main/java/org/apache/sling/distribution/{util => queue/spi}/package-info.java (92%)
--
To stop receiving notification emails like this one, please contact
tmaret@apache.org.